After staying away from the spotlight for over a decade, Las Vegas-born rock band The Cab returns with a refreshed sense of purpose. Their latest album, "Chasing Crowns," is more than fans could have ever asked for and is exactly what we need to continue the year off strong in music. The 18-track project weaves together over 10 years of growth, both musically and personally from the guys. Capturing who they used to be and who they've proudly become, a beautiful journey from The Cab's true roots to their evolution as artists.
As they step back into the music scene, you can also catch them on their long-awaited headlining run — the "Back From The Dead" tour — this summer.
